I have a personal Confluence Cloud account. It was setup with an email I no longer have access to. When I try to logon to this account I get a message that I need to change my password because the password was compromised on another site. But I can't change the password because I no longer have access to the email account.
The advice from support is "You will need support assistance to make <my new email> a site admin of the cloud site. You will need to reach-out to our online Atlassian Community for technical support assistance."

Did you contact Atlassian via https://support.atlassian.com/contact/ ? Did they send you to the community for this?
I find it very odd if they did that as this is clearly an account issue. If you can't access your site or your MAC (my.atlassian.com) with the email that owns the site, only Atlassian themselves can help.
I'd give them another nudge and explain them that you lost all access to the account and therefor have no way to add new site admins yourself.
